Tashelhit
Etymology
Inherited from Proto-Berber, from Proto-Afroasiatic. Compare Proto-Chadic *təra (“star”) (Hausa tàurārṑ). Likely unrelated to Proto-Indo-European *h₂stḗr (“star”).
Cognate with Zenaga äđäri (“star”), Tuareg atăr, atri (“star”), Tetserret atri (“star”), Central Atlas Tamazight ⵉⵜⵔⵉ (itri, “star”), Ghadames iri (“star”), Sokna îri (“star”), Tarifit itri (“star”).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/itri/
Noun
itri m (plural itran, feminine equivalent titrit, Tifinagh spelling ⵉⵜⵔⵉ, Arabic spelling ايتري)
- star
- آر يتّانّاي يتران. ― ar ittannay itran. ― he's watching the stars.
Inflection
| singular | plural | |
|---|---|---|
| free state | itri | itran |
| annexed state | yitri | yitran, itran |
Derived terms
- amagus n itran (“vagabond”)
- itri bu ucwwal (“comet”)
- itri iɣzzifn (“comet”)
- itri n lqalb (“north star”)
- itri n ṣbaḥ (“morning star”)
